The Boy With the Red Hair is the emotional story of a jaded aristocratic who finds himself overcome with a paralysing infatuation for his young serving boy.Set in the 1700s, it is both a period drama and a study of the power of physical beauty to overcome that most common of common senses - self-preservation.But this unusual tale of addictive love takes a darker twist when the serving boy does not offer quite such an idyll of rosy youth as it first appears, bringing instead intrigue and jealousy into a love triangle that ultimately ends in violence and death.This novella is accompanied by Nothing But A Negro - the short story which, in turn, inspired The Boy With The Red Hair - which tells the true story of Robinson Crusoe and what really went down in that desert island paradise…
